What Are Storage & Data Transfer Cables?
Storage and data transfer cables are designed to connect storage devices (like hard drives, SSDs, and optical drives) to computers, servers, and external enclosures. They facilitate data exchange, power delivery, and secure communication, making them vital for both performance and stability.
Common Types of Storage & Data Transfer Cables:
-
SATA (Serial ATA) Cables
-
Used to connect internal HDDs and SSDs.
-
Support high-speed data transfer up to 6 Gbps.
-
Ideal for desktops, servers, and workstations.
-
-
SAS (Serial Attached SCSI) Cables
-
High-performance cables for enterprise storage systems.
-
Support data rates up to 12 Gbps or more.
-
Designed for servers and data centers.
-
-
USB Data Cables (USB 2.0 / 3.0 / 3.2 / Type-C)
-
Connect external hard drives, flash drives, and peripherals.
-
Speeds vary from 480 Mbps to 20 Gbps (USB 3.2 Gen 2x2).
-
Universally compatible with PCs, laptops, and docking stations.
-
-
eSATA Cables
-
External SATA interface for high-speed external drives.
-
Offers similar performance to internal SATA connections.
-
-
Thunderbolt Cables (Thunderbolt 3 / 4)
-
High-end cables for ultra-fast data transfer (up to 40 Gbps).
-
Ideal for professionals handling large files, like video editors.
-
-
IDE (PATA) Cables
-
Legacy cables for older hard drives and optical drives.
-
Still useful for maintaining and repairing vintage systems.
-
-
FireWire (IEEE 1394) Cables
-
Used in older multimedia and video editing equipment.
-
Provides reliable, low-latency data transmission.

Choosing the Right Cable:
When selecting a storage or data cable, consider:
-
Device Compatibility: Match the cable type to your drive interface (SATA, USB, SAS, etc.).
-
Speed Requirements: Choose cables that support your drive’s maximum transfer rate.
-
Length & Build Quality: Opt for shielded, durable cables for longer runs.
-
Connector Type: Verify USB-A, USB-C, or other interface compatibility.
